(Dr. Khanna begins to explain the Lasik procedure using charts and models.)

Dr. Khanna: Lasik is a quick, minimally invasive procedure that reshapes the cornea to correct vision problems. It’s performed using a state-of-the-art laser, which allows for incredible precision and control. The entire surgery typically takes less than 10 minutes per eye, and most patients notice a significant improvement in their vision within just a few days.

Samantha: (Still nervous) But what about the risks? I’ve heard stories of people experiencing side effects or complications.

Dr. Khanna: Like any surgical procedure, there are some risks involved. However, the risks associated with Lasik are very low. Less than 1% of patients experience serious complications, and the vast majority of those are treatable. Common side effects, such as dry eyes and temporary visual disturbances, usually resolve on their own within a few weeks or months.
